What is a CCIE Data Center Course? 

CCIE Data Center Course prepares learners for advanced data centre networking and infrastructure concepts associated with Cisco’s expert-level certification pathway. The training focuses on designing, implementing, operating, and troubleshooting complex data centre environments. 

A typical CCIE Data Center Course can cover data centre architecture, networking, storage connectivity, virtualization, automation, security, monitoring, and troubleshooting. The exact syllabus can vary depending on the training provider and the current Cisco certification blueprint, so learners should always confirm the latest course outline before enrolling. 

The biggest difference between basic networking training and a CCIE Data Center Course is the depth of practical problem-solving. Instead of only learning what a technology does, you learn how different technologies work together in a large environment and how to diagnose problems when something goes wrong. 

Which networking fundamentals will you master? 

A strong CCIE Data Center Course builds on networking fundamentals because advanced data centre work depends on a solid understanding of how networks communicate. 

You can expect to strengthen your knowledge of Ethernet, IP addressing, routing, switching, VLANs, subnetting, and network services. You will also learn how traffic moves through interconnected devices and how to design reliable communication between servers, applications, and users. 

For someone already working in IT support or networking, these units can help turn theoretical knowledge into practical troubleshooting ability. You begin to look at a network as an interconnected system rather than a collection of separate devices. 

How does data centre architecture feature in the course? 

Data centre architecture is one of the central areas of a CCIE Data Center Course. You learn how modern data centres are structured and why different components are placed where they are. 

Topics may include data centre design principles, physical and logical architecture, redundancy, high availability, scalability, and traffic flows. The goal is to understand how organisations build infrastructure that can continue supporting critical applications while reducing downtime. 

This knowledge is useful because businesses increasingly depend on digital services. Banks, hospitals, universities, e-commerce companies, government agencies, and cloud providers all need dependable infrastructure behind their applications. 

What will you learn about data centre switching? 

Switching is another major component of a CCIE Data Center Course. You will explore advanced switching concepts and how switches are used to connect servers, storage systems, and other network devices. 

Depending on the syllabus, you may encounter technologies and concepts such as VLANs, trunking, link aggregation, Spanning Tree Protocol, and Cisco data centre switching platforms. You also learn how to design resilient switching environments and troubleshoot connectivity problems. 

The practical side matters. A professional needs to understand not only how to configure a switch, but also how to identify the cause of a performance or connectivity issue in a complex environment. 

How important is routing in a CCIE Data Center Course? 

Routing determines how traffic reaches different networks, making it a critical skill in advanced infrastructure. A CCIE Data Center Course therefore gives attention to routing concepts and the role of routing protocols in enterprise environments. 

You may study route selection, routing tables, static and dynamic routing, and protocols used in large networks. The emphasis is usually on understanding how routing decisions affect availability, performance, and scalability. 

These skills can be valuable when working with organisations that have multiple sites, large server environments, or hybrid infrastructure. 

What will you learn about virtualization? 

Virtualization has transformed the way modern data centres use computing resources. A CCIE Data Center Course introduces learners to the networking considerations that come with virtualised servers and infrastructure. 

You may explore virtual switches, virtual network interfaces, segmentation, virtual machines, and communication between physical and virtual environments. You also learn why visibility and configuration consistency become more important as organisations move from a few physical servers to highly virtualised environments. 

For IT professionals, this is a useful bridge between traditional networking and modern data centre operations. 

How does storage networking fit into the course? 

Data centre networking is not only about moving user traffic. Servers also need reliable access to storage. A CCIE Data Center Course therefore covers storage networking concepts and the relationship between compute, network, and storage resources. 

Depending on the training programme, topics may include Fibre Channel, Fibre Channel over Ethernet, storage area networks, storage connectivity, and related data centre technologies. 

The objective is to understand how storage traffic is transported, segmented, prioritised, and protected. This is especially relevant in environments where databases and business applications depend on fast and reliable access to large amounts of data. 

What automation skills can you gain? 

Automation is increasingly important in modern infrastructure, and a CCIE Data Center Course can introduce you to ways of managing networks more efficiently through automation. 

You may learn about APIs, programmability, configuration automation, infrastructure management, and tools or approaches used to reduce repetitive manual work. Instead of configuring every device individually, automation allows teams to apply consistent changes across larger environments. 

This is an important career skill because employers want IT professionals who can improve efficiency while reducing configuration errors. Basic scripting and an understanding of automation workflows can therefore make your networking knowledge more valuable. 

What security skills are covered? 

Security is closely connected to every part of a data centre. A CCIE Data Center Course may cover segmentation, access control, secure management, threat reduction, and security considerations for network and infrastructure design. 

The aim is not simply to add security after a network has been built. You learn to consider security during architecture, configuration, monitoring, and troubleshooting. 

This approach is increasingly important in Kenya as organisations digitise financial services, education, healthcare, retail, and public services. A networking professional who understands security principles can contribute to safer infrastructure. 

How will the course improve your troubleshooting skills? 

Troubleshooting is arguably one of the most valuable outcomes of a CCIE Data Center Course. Advanced infrastructure rarely fails in a neat, obvious way. A connectivity issue could involve routing, switching, configuration, storage, virtualisation, security policies, or an interaction between several systems. 

Training helps you develop a structured troubleshooting approach. You learn to gather evidence, isolate a fault, test possible causes, interpret system information, and implement a solution without creating additional problems. 

These are transferable skills. Even when you move to a different technology or employer, the ability to diagnose complex technical problems remains useful. 

What practical skills will you master in a CCIE Data Center Course? 

A good CCIE Data Center Course should go beyond theory. Through labs and practical exercises, learners can build experience with configuration, verification, monitoring, troubleshooting, and design decisions. 

You may practise setting up network services, connecting infrastructure components, testing configurations, analysing faults, and restoring normal operations. Repeated lab work helps you become more comfortable with the command line and with thinking through technical problems systematically. 

Practical training is particularly important if your long-term goal is to work as a network engineer, data centre engineer, infrastructure engineer, systems administrator, or technical consultant.

Is a CCIE Data Center Course difficult? 

Yes, it can be challenging, especially if you are new to advanced networking. The programme involves several connected areas, so learners need patience, regular practice, and a willingness to troubleshoot instead of memorising commands. 

The difficulty should not discourage you. A sensible approach is to strengthen networking fundamentals first, practise regularly, build small lab environments, and gradually tackle more complex scenarios. 

What should you know before enrolling in a CCIE Data Center Course? 

Before choosing a CCIE Data Center Course, review the syllabus carefully. Confirm the current Cisco certification structure, prerequisites or recommended experience, laboratory access, instructor credentials, learning schedule, and examination preparation support. 

It is also worth asking how much practical work is included. Data centre skills are easier to understand when you can configure systems, make mistakes, investigate the results, and correct them in a controlled lab environment. 

How should you prepare effectively for a CCIE Data Center Course? 

Start by revising networking fundamentals. Make sure you are comfortable with IP addressing, subnetting, VLANs, routing, switching, and basic network troubleshooting. 

Next, spend time in hands-on labs. Practise reading configurations and understanding why a particular command or design decision is used. You should also develop basic automation awareness because programmability is increasingly connected to network engineering. 

Finally, build the habit of documenting what you learn. Writing down the problem, evidence, diagnosis, solution, and lesson learned can make troubleshooting practice much more effective.
